Jean-Jacques Kiladjian: Inserm Grand Est Meeting on Clinical Research at CIC Strasbourg
Jean-Jacques Kiladjian, Head of Clinical Research Department of Inserm, Professor of Medicine at the University of Paris Cité, President of the FIM, shared a post on LinkedIn:
”A beautiful day organized by Eric Simon and the regional management Inserm Grand Est around the Clinical Investigation Center CIC Strasbourg.
Explanations and in-depth discussion with Strasbourg University Hospital Center (CHRU de Strasbourg – Strasbourg University Hospitals) and the University of Strasbourg on the role of Inserm in clinical research, the specificities of a Clinical Investigation Center (CIC), the advantages of this joint label between the Directorate General for Healthcare Provision (DGOS) and Inserm, and the place of universities in this system.”
